Spotlight (Tír na nÓg album)
Spotlight is the second live album by Irish band Tír na nÓg. It contains recordings from the BBC archive including some tracks from the John Peel Sessions with the band.

Recording and broadcast details
Track 1 recorded 4 September 1972 at Playhouse Theatre, London.
- Broadcast 17 October 1972.
- Produced by John Walters. Engineered by Bob Conduct.
Tracks 6, 7, 8, 9, 10 & 11 recorded 16 September 1972 at Playhouse Theatre, London.
Tracks 12 & 13 recorded 15 January 1973 at Langham 1 studio, London.
- Broadcast 1 February 1973.
- Produced and Engineered by Bernie Andrews.
Tracks 2, 3, 4 & 5 recorded 23 October 1973 at Langham 1 studio, London.
- Broadcast 13 November 1973.
- Produced and Engineered by Tony Wilson.
